Sectra secures large mammography PACS order: Northern Ireland expands its region-wide healthcare imaging IT solution with digital breast imaging


The department of Health, Social Services and Public Safety in Northern Ireland
has expanded its PACS contract with Sectra (http://www.sectra.com/medical) (STO:
SECT B), to include digital breast imaging.  The breast screening centres in the
region will benefit immediately from the existing centralized PACS facilitating
efficient image handling and information sharing across all of Northern
Ireland.
programme is transitioning to digital imaging. To support this transition the
existing region-wide PACS solution provided by Sectra in 2010 is being extended
to include dedicated breast imaging functionality.

Northern Ireland has one of the world’s largest and most integrated region-wide
imaging healthcare IT solutions where images and patient information is handled
in a single database. In total 1.4 million radiology and mammography
examinations are carried out every year. The installation includes 27 hospitals,
organized in five Trusts, and four breast screening centres.

The additional functionality supports the unique workflow of digital breast
imaging of high-volume screening and advanced diagnostic mammography.

About Sectra
Sectra was founded in 1978 and has its roots in Linköping University in Sweden.
The company’s business operation includes cutting-edge products and services
within the niche segments of medical systems and secure communication systems.
Sectra has offices in 12 countries and operates through partners worldwide.
Sales in the 2012/2013 fiscal year totaled SEK 817 million. The Sectra share is
quoted on the NASDAQ OMX Stockholm AB exchange. For more information,
visit www.sectra.com (http://www.sectra.comIn)

In the medical market, Sectra develops and sells IT systems and services for
radiology and other image-intensive departments, orthopaedics and rheumatology.
More than 1,400 hospitals, clinics and imaging centers worldwide use the systems
daily, together performing over 70 million radiology examinations annually. This
makes Sectra one of the world-leading companies within systems for handling
digital radiology images. In Scandinavia, Sectra is the market leader with more
than 50% of all film-free installations. Sectra’s systems have been installed in
North America, Scandinavia and most major countries in Europe and the Far East.
